## When NOT to use embedbase

- * Avoid using Embedbase if your application's technology stack cannot effectively integrate TypeScript, as its primary language support is in this framework and not others like Python.
- * Do not use it when you need extensive customization options for the vector database configurations beyond what pgvector or Supabase offers.

## When NOT to use redis-vl-python

- If your project does not require integration with Redis or Python is not an option for implementation.
- For applications needing only basic key-value storage, as RedisVL introduces additional overhead with its specialized AI-native features.
- When you are looking for a simpler vector database that doesn't support intricate embedding management and large language model integrations.
- If your project requires a solution that does not carry the MIT license, implying an unwillingness or inability to handle open-source licensing conditions.
